From 2fb8a5b9e0dab0c31a6ef3e0911a9f561e4ad341 Mon Sep 17 00:00:00 2001 From: staffadmin Date: Sun, 28 Jul 2024 20:58:16 +0200 Subject: [PATCH] [add grafana] --- swarm.yml | 23 +++++++++++++---------- 1 file changed, 13 insertions(+), 10 deletions(-) diff --git a/swarm.yml b/swarm.yml index 8f653a3..f1ba3cb 100644 --- a/swarm.yml +++ b/swarm.yml @@ -338,16 +338,19 @@ - grafana-lib:/var/lib/grafana environment: GF_INSTALL_PLUGINS: "grafana-clock-panel,grafana-simple-json-datasource,grafana-worldmap-panel,grafana-piechart-panel" - labels: - - "traefik.enable=true" - # HTTP Routers - - "traefik.http.routers.grafana-rtr.entrypoints=websecure" - - "traefik.http.routers.grafana-rtr.rule=Host(`grafana2.jingoh.private`)" - # Middlewares - - "traefik.http.routers.grafana-rtr.middlewares=privatevpn,forward-auth" - # HTTP Services - - "traefik.http.routers.grafana-rtr.service=grafana-svc" - - "traefik.http.services.grafana-svc.loadbalancer.server.port=3000" + deploy: + mode: replicated + replicas: 1 + labels: + - "traefik.enable=true" + # HTTP Routers + - "traefik.http.routers.grafana-rtr.entrypoints=websecure" + - "traefik.http.routers.grafana-rtr.rule=Host(`grafana2.jingoh.private`)" + # Middlewares + - "traefik.http.routers.grafana-rtr.middlewares=privatevpn,forward-auth" + # HTTP Services + - "traefik.http.routers.grafana-rtr.service=grafana-svc" + - "traefik.http.services.grafana-svc.loadbalancer.server.port=3000" networks: public: external: true